Transaction 80e3277143ed12a3a907231a590b3a20a47c8205084f15a905acd0667e7b608c

1 Input
2 Outputs
  • 80e3277143ed12a3a907231a590b3a20a47c8205084f15a905acd0667e7b608c:0
  • value  73030000
    address  32pc7jc7bmDmZonLJh11ZQEFLPiE8ReSd5
  • 80e3277143ed12a3a907231a590b3a20a47c8205084f15a905acd0667e7b608c:1
  • value  30642040194
    address  1HEk3w84mHzCGn41ijEndptjMUrzUsejkV